Choosing a Car Seat Pram

Choosing the right car seat pram is one of the most important choices new parents will make. You'll need something that is user-friendly and suited to your lifestyle.

Car seat/pram combos generally only be used for infants (new-born up to 1 year old) therefore you'll need to purchase a new stroller once you reach that age.

Comfort

Car seat prams should be comfortable for both the child and parent to ensure they feel at ease on the road. It is essential to have plenty of padding on the seat as well as an adjustable handlebar that can be adjusted to provide an appropriate fit. Some models also have an attractive shade canopy and pockets for stowing to keep your baby snug. It is also essential that the pram be easy to use with a one-handed strap attachment and that it easily detaches from the base to help you save time and effort.

It is also crucial that the pram is easy to clean. This is particularly true if it has fabric that can be machine-washed. Some of our top picks, including the Mountain Buggy Nano, feature a removable fabric seat to clean. This is an excellent feature for parents who don't have a lot of time to spend tinkering with their equipment.

Safety

The car seat is among the most beneficial investments you can make for your child, since it protects them while traveling. There are a number of safety features to consider when selecting the right car seat.

A carrycot connected to the chassis of a pram allows your baby to lay flat. This is great for lung and best Prams spine development. Also, you should ensure that your car seat has five-point harnesses that is comprised of two straps to secure the shoulders and two straps that cross over the hips. Make sure that your car seat is fitted with a front adjuster to tighten the harness, as well as an adjustable maximum recline of 45 degrees to avoid suffocation.

Brands will have different weight and height restrictions for their infant car seats. Make sure that your child is in compliance with these requirements and also those of the stroller. Stanton suggests that when buying a compact travel pram set the car seat and stroller must be able to connect seamlessly and meet the federal motor vehicle safety standards.

graco-stadium-duo-tandem-double-pushchair-suitable-from-birth-to-approx-3-years-15kgs-car-seat-compatible-with-snugessentials-isize-infant-car-seat-black-grey-fashion-773.jpgIf you're not sure how to install your car seat, consult an experienced child safety technician in a hospital or fire department. They will provide you with precise instructions and answer any questions that you might have.

You'll also have to decide whether you would like your child's car seat to come with a top tether strap, which is a tether that attaches to the seat via a hook embedded in the back seat or trunk. The tether will stop the head of your child from bouncing forward during a crash. This reduces the risk of injury to the head.

When you are choosing a car seat pram, make sure the car seat and base fit snuggly and that the locking devices are easy to operate by hand. Make sure to lock the chassis prior to folding your pram. This will prevent you from folding the pram while your child is still in the seat.
